What is Dropshipping and Why Choose the UK Market?

Dropshipping is a retail fulfillment method where a store doesn't keep the products it sells in stock. Instead, when a customer places an order, the store purchases the item from a third-party supplier who ships it directly to the customer. This means you don't have to handle inventory, manage warehouse space, or deal with shipping logistics.

The UK market is particularly attractive for dropshipping for several reasons:

  • Strong consumer spending power: UK consumers are accustomed to online shopping, with e-commerce accounting for a significant portion of retail sales.
  • Excellent logistics infrastructure: The UK has well-developed postal and courier systems, making domestic delivery fast and reliable.
  • English-speaking market: You can easily create content, communicate with customers, and handle customer service without language barriers.
  • Legal and financial stability: The UK has clear regulations for e-commerce businesses, making it easier to operate legally.

Finding Reliable Dropshipping Suppliers in the UK

One of the biggest challenges for UK dropshippers is finding suppliers that offer fast shipping, quality products, and good customer service. While many people look to AliExpress or other overseas suppliers, shipping times from China to the UK can take 2-4 weeks, which often leads to unhappy customers.

If you want to provide a better customer experience, consider working with UK-based suppliers or fulfillment centers that offer faster delivery. Many UK dropshipping suppliers specialize in specific niches, such as home decor, fashion, electronics, or pet supplies.

When choosing a supplier, pay attention to:

  • Shipping times: Look for suppliers that offer 2-5 day delivery within the UK.
  • Product quality: Order samples to test the quality before listing products.
  • Return policies: Understand the supplier's return process so you can handle customer issues smoothly.
  • Inventory accuracy: Ensure the supplier updates stock levels regularly to avoid selling out-of-stock items.

Setting Up Your Dropshipping Store

Once you have your supplier lined up, the next step is building your online store. For UK dropshipping, you can use platforms like Shopify, WooCommerce (WordPress), or BigCommerce. These platforms integrate with various dropshipping apps that help you import products, manage orders, and track shipments.

When designing your store, keep these UK-specific considerations in mind:

  • Display prices in GBP (£): Always show prices in British pounds to avoid confusion.
  • Include VAT information: UK customers are familiar with VAT-inclusive pricing, so make sure your store clearly states whether VAT is included.
  • Use UK-friendly payment gateways: Offer popular UK payment methods like Visa, Mastercard, PayPal, and Klarna.
  • Localize your content: Use British English spelling (e.g., "colour" instead of "color", "centre" instead of "center").

  • Legal Considerations for UK Dropshippers

    Operating a dropshipping business in the UK requires compliance with several laws and regulations:

    • Consumer Rights Act 2015: You must provide clear information about products, prices, and return policies.
    • UK GDPR: If you collect customer data, you need to comply with data protection laws.
    • VAT registration: If your business turnover exceeds £85,000, you must register for VAT with HMRC.
    • Distance Selling Regulations: Customers have the right to cancel orders within 14 days of receiving goods.

    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them

    Dropshipping in the UK isn't without its difficulties. Here are some common challenges and solutions:

    • Long shipping times: Work with UK-based suppliers or use fulfillment services that stock products locally.
    • Customer service issues: Respond quickly to emails and messages. A good customer experience can turn a complaint into a positive review.
    • Competition: Differentiate your store by focusing on a specific niche, offering exceptional customer service, or creating unique product bundles.
    • Profit margins: Find suppliers that offer competitive wholesale prices, and consider bundling products to increase average order value.
